
作为开源数据库管理系统中的佼佼者,MySQL凭借其高性能、稳定性和灵活性,在各行各业中扮演着至关重要的角色
然而,随着数据量的爆炸式增长,传统命令行界面的MySQL管理方式逐渐显露出其局限性——操作复杂、效率低下、错误率高
正是在这一背景下,MySQL图形化版工具应运而生,它们以直观、便捷的操作界面,极大地简化了数据库的管理过程,成为数据库管理员和开发者的得力助手
一、MySQL图形化版工具概述 MySQL图形化版工具,顾名思义,是指通过图形用户界面(GUI)来管理MySQL数据库的软件
这类工具通常集成了数据库设计、数据导入导出、查询执行、用户权限管理、性能监控等多种功能于一体,旨在为用户提供一种更加直观、易于上手的管理方式
相较于命令行操作,图形化工具不仅能够显著降低学习成本,还能有效减少人为错误,提高管理效率
二、核心功能解析 1.数据库设计与建模 图形化版工具允许用户以拖拽的方式创建数据库表、设置字段属性、建立外键关系等,无需编写复杂的SQL语句
部分高级工具还支持ER图(实体关系图)的自动生成与编辑,帮助开发者直观理解数据库结构,优化设计模式
2.数据导入导出 数据迁移和备份是数据库管理中的常见任务
图形化工具提供了丰富的数据导入导出选项,支持多种文件格式(如CSV、Excel、JSON等),极大地简化了数据在不同系统间的传输过程
同时,自动化备份与恢复功能确保了数据的安全性与连续性
3.查询编辑与执行 虽然图形化界面减少了直接编写SQL的需求,但对于高级用户而言,强大的查询编辑器依然不可或缺
这些工具通常支持语法高亮、自动补全、执行计划查看等功能,使编写和优化SQL查询变得更加高效
此外,结果集的可视化展示(如图表、报表)也让数据分析工作变得直观易懂
4.用户权限管理 安全是数据库管理的基石
图形化工具简化了用户账户的创建、角色分配及权限设置流程,管理员可以轻松管理谁可以访问哪些数据库、执行哪些操作,从而确保数据访问的合规性与安全性
5.性能监控与优化 高效的数据库管理离不开对性能的持续关注
图形化工具提供了实时监控面板,展示数据库的运行状态、查询性能、资源消耗等关键指标,帮助管理员及时发现并解决性能瓶颈
部分工具还集成了自动化调优建议,进一步简化了优化工作
三、市场主流工具概览 1.phpMyAdmin phpMyAdmin是最早也是最知名的MySQL图形化管理工具之一,尤其受PHP开发者的喜爱
它提供了完整的数据库管理功能,界面简洁直观,且完全免费
尽管功能强大,但对于大型数据库或复杂操作,其性能可能略显不足
2.MySQL Workbench MySQL官方推出的MySQL Workbench,集成了数据库设计、建模、迁移、管理等多种功能,是专业数据库管理员的首选
其强大的数据建模工具、查询优化器以及性能分析工具,使得从设计到部署的全过程都能得到有效支持
3.DBeaver DBeaver是一款通用数据库管理工具,支持包括MySQL在内的多种数据库系统
它以其丰富的功能集、灵活的插件机制以及跨平台兼容性而著称
无论是数据库新手还是高级用户,都能在其中找到适合自己的功能
4.HeidiSQL HeidiSQL是一款轻量级但功能强大的MySQL管理工具,特别适合Windows用户
其界面友好、操作简便,支持快速的数据导入导出、查询编辑及数据库同步,是许多开发者日常工作的得力助手
四、图形化工具带来的变革 1.提升工作效率 图形化界面的直观性和易用性极大地缩短了数据库管理任务的执行时间,无论是日常的数据维护还是复杂的项目部署,都能快速高效地完成
2.降低学习门槛 对于非技术背景或数据库初学者而言,图形化工具降低了学习成本,使他们能够更快地上手数据库管理,促进了团队内部的协作与知识共享
3.增强数据安全性 通过简化用户权限管理和自动化备份恢复流程,图形化工具有效提升了数据库系统的安全性,降低了因人为错误导致的数据泄露或丢失风险
4.促进创新与发展 图形化工具提供的强大功能和灵活扩展性,为数据库管理员和开发者提供了更多探索和实践的空间,促进了数据库技术的不断创新与应用拓展
五、结语 综上所述,MySQL图形化版工具以其直观的操作界面、丰富的功能集以及显著的工作效率提升,已成为现代数据库管理中不可或缺的一部分
它们不仅简化了复杂的数据库管理任务,还促进了团队之间的协作与创新,为企业数字化转型提供了坚实的基础
随着技术的不断进步,我们有理由相信,未来的MySQL图形化工具将更加智能化、自动化,为数据库管理领域带来更多的惊喜与可能
在这个数据驱动的时代,选择一款适合自己的图形化工具,无疑是对数据库管理者和开发者的一次重要投资,它将助力企业在数据海洋中航行得更远、更稳
MySQL字段添加注释指南
MySQL图形化版:数据库管理新体验
如何设置MySQL上传文件大小限制
MySQL进阶实战:掌握游标的高效使用技巧
MySQL INT字段类型数值范围详解
MySQL重装失败?解决指南来了!
MySQL开发规范必读指南
MySQL字段添加注释指南
如何设置MySQL上传文件大小限制
MySQL进阶实战:掌握游标的高效使用技巧
MySQL INT字段类型数值范围详解
MySQL重装失败?解决指南来了!
MySQL开发规范必读指南
MySQL服务期限将至,如何应对?
安装MySQL后缺失Docs文件怎么办
MySQL高级技巧:掌握视图嵌套,提升数据库查询效率
MySQL数据插入顺序指南
打造具前景的高可用性MySQL解决方案
MySQL8.0适配JDK版本全解析